Adjective[change]

Positive
buggy

Comparative
buggier

Superlative
buggiest

  1. If something is buggy, it is infested with insects.
  2. (computing) If a software is buggy, it contains programming errors.
    This software is so buggy that I don't know how anyone can use it!
